Mental Illness Defined
Mental illness is defined as disease, dysfunction, or disruption of the brain, leading to negative thoughts and behaviors. There are many different types of mental illness and each can impact a person differently.

Paying for Murdock Mental Health Rehab
Everything costs something - including mental healthcare The cost of housing, medication, therapy, and all other aspects of recovery can add up. Someone has to pay them. In the United States, the most common method of paying for any type of health care is insurance. However, this isn’t the only option. Additional payment options include Medicare and Medicaid, self-payment, scholarships, and free programs:
- Private Insurance may be available through your employer or your spouse/parent’s employer. You can also sign up for your own private insurance plan directly through a private insurance provider.
- Subsidized Private Insurance is available through an online marketplace to individuals who earn a low income, but also do not qualify for medicare/medicaid.
- Medicare - A government-funded healthcare option available to individuals over the age of 65.
- Medicaid - A government-funded healthcare option available to low-income individuals and families.Medicare/Medicaid- Government-funded healthcare options for those below a certain income or over the age of 65.
- Self-payment] - Those who can afford it may pay for their mental health rehabilitation Murdock out-of-pocket. Payment plans and credit options may be available for self-pay clients.
- Scholarships - Some mental health rehab centers Murdock offer a scholarship for individuals who express a strong yearning and dedication to healing, but otherwise would not have the financial means] to pay for [the treatment they need.
- “Free” Programs - Certain organizations use the funds to provide mental health treatment to their local community. Unfortunately, it is common to see a long waitlist in areas with a greater need for these services.
